我的知识记录

网站源代码里的内容修改什么时候生效

网站源代码的修改是网站维护和优化过程中非常重要的一环。源代码的修改可能涉及到网站的功能、界面、性能等多个方面。那么,源代码的修改何时生效呢?这取决于多种因素,包括服务器配置、缓存机制、DNS更新等。本文将详细解析源代码修改生效的时间和影响因素,帮助网站管理员更好地掌握网站维护的流程。

源代码修改与服务器同步

源代码的修改需要上传到服务器。这个过程的时间取决于文件的大小和服务器的响应速度。一般小规模的修改可以迅速上传并生效,而大规模的代码更新可能需要更多的时间来同步。

缓存机制对生效时间的影响

许多网站都会使用缓存机制来提高访问速度。这意味着用户访问网站时,实际上是访问的缓存文件而非最新的源代码。因此,即使源代码已经修改并上传到服务器,用户也可能因为缓存而看不到最新的内容。清除缓存是让源代码修改生效的关键步骤。

DNS更新对生效时间的影响

DNS(域名系统)是将域名解析为IP地址的系统。如果网站的IP地址发生了变化,那么DNS需要更新以反映这一变化。DNS更新的时间可能从几秒到48小时不等,这取决于DNS服务商的设置。在DNS更新完成之前,用户可能无法访问到最新的网站源代码。

浏览器缓存的影响

除了服务器和DNS的缓存,用户的浏览器也会缓存网站文件。这意味着即使服务器上的源代码已经更新,用户也可能因为浏览器缓存而看到旧的内容。清除浏览器缓存是让用户看到最新源代码修改的有效方法。

代码修改的复杂性

源代码修改的复杂性也会影响生效时间。简单的文本修改可能很快就能生效,而涉及到数据库、服务器配置等复杂修改可能需要更多的时间来测试和部署。

测试与部署

在源代码修改完成后,通常需要进行测试以确保修改没有引入新的错误。测试的时间取决于网站的复杂性和测试的范围。测试通过后,修改才会被部署到生产环境,这时用户才能看到最新的源代码。

网站源代码的修改生效时间受到多种因素的影响,包括服务器同步、缓存机制、DNS更新等。为了确保源代码修改能够及时生效,网站管理员需要了解这些因素,并采取相应的措施,如清除缓存、更新DNS等。同时,也要注意代码修改的复杂性和测试部署的过程,以确保网站的稳定性和用户体验。

网站源代码里的内容修改什么时候生效

标签:

更新时间:2025-06-19 23:47:06

上一篇:MySQL数据库登录命令

下一篇:网站统计代码插入WordPress主题哪个位置?